Has Christmas ever seemed too much to grasp with its rushing here and there to buy and exchange gifts, to visit and feast with all the relatives and friends, and to celebrate until your heart is so worn out that it can no longer find any meaning in the feast at all? Then read The Mystery of the Christmas Dollhouse and see how a single gift given so tenderly by an innocent child can change the routine of gift giving ever after. If you truly wish to appreciate Christmas and to understand a little more its deeper meanings, then see it from nine year old Melanie Wassels little heart when she comes to live with her new parents, Emil and Ruth Wassel for Christmas 1956. By understanding the mysteries surrounding Melanie Wassel and her aloofness for what her new parents believe Christmas ought to be, you will come to realize with her how Christmas, the greatest of Christian feasts, is a feast of children, about children and for children, no matter how old or young they may be!
